Product Overview

The STM8S005K6T6C from STMicroelectronics is a value-line 8-bit STM8S microcontroller running at 16MHz with 32KB Flash, 1KB true data EEPROM, 1KB SRAM, 10-bit ADC, timers, UART, SPI, and I2C interfaces in a 32-pin LQFP package.

Key Specifications

Manufacturer STMicroelectronics
Core STM8 8-bit
Max Clock Frequency 16MHz
Flash Memory 32KB
SRAM 1KB
Data EEPROM 1KB
ADC 10-bit, up to 5 channels
Timers 1x 16-bit, 1x 8-bit
Communication UART, SPI, I2C
I/O Pins up to 25
Operating Voltage 2.95V to 5.5V
Package 32-LQFP (7x7mm)
Operating Temperature -40C to +85C

The STMicroelectronics STM8S005K6T6C is a value-line 8-bit microcontroller from the STM8S series. It features the STM8 core with Harvard architecture and a 3-stage pipeline running at up to 16MHz. The device integrates 32KB Flash program memory, 1KB true data EEPROM, and 1KB SRAM. On-chip peripherals include a 10-bit ADC with up to 5 channels, a 16-bit advanced timer, an 8-bit general-purpose timer, UART, SPI, and I2C interfaces. The 2.95V to 5.5V operating voltage range provides flexibility for both 3.3V and 5V systems. The 32-pin LQFP package offers up to 25 GPIO pins for versatile I/O configuration.

The STM8S005K6T6C operates as a complete 8-bit microcontroller system: 1) STM8 Core: The 8-bit CPU executes instructions from Flash memory using a 3-stage pipeline (fetch, decode, execute) achieving near 1 MIPS/MHz throughput. The Harvard architecture provides separate program and data buses for efficient execution. 2) Memory Subsystem: 32KB Flash stores program code, 1KB EEPROM provides non-volatile data storage with high endurance, and 1KB SRAM handles runtime data. 3) Peripheral Subsystem: The ADC converts analog signals to 10-bit digital values. Timers provide PWM generation, input capture, and event counting. Communication interfaces (UART, SPI, I2C) enable serial data exchange with external devices. 4) Clock System: An internal RC oscillator (16MHz) provides the default clock, with external crystal support for precision applications.
